Transaction 57c0a4b51303a028ba915347cde21f67bf965bb50d366f739f862b370407438e
1 Input
1 Output
-
57c0a4b51303a028ba915347cde21f67bf965bb50d366f739f862b370407438e:0
- value
- 2567626
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 575482390067110daa305145a17c05a4e2c57663 OP_EQUAL
- address
- 39emwzuWQ71PWHCmjjgWREDuv4XdvbDM7C